Figure 1-12 L6-20 Power Cable Conversion Factors and Formulas The conversion factors provided in this section are intended to ease data calculation when planning for systems that do not conform specifically to the configurations listed in this guide. The following list includes the conversion factors used in this document, as well as additional conversion factors that might be helpful in determining those calculations required for site planning. Conversion Factors • Refrigeration - 1 watt = 0.86 kcal/hour - 1 watt = 3.412 Btu/hour - 1 watt = 2.843 × 10-4 tons - 1 ton = 200 Btu/minute - 1 ton = 12,000 Btu/hour - 1 ton = 3,517.2 watts • Metric Equivalents - 1 centimeter = 0.3937 inch - 1 meter = 3.28 foot - 1 meter = 1.09 yards - 1 in. = 2.54 centimeters Conversion Factors and Formulas 29
